Bear in mind the cost of the alcohol that you will be serving at your wedding, and try to find one that is cost efficient. The open bar option is the most costly of choices and the cost can be prohibitive for many couples but do not feel bad if you cannot afford it. See what other serving options are available for your alcohol.

Wedding Dress

Finding your perfect wedding dress might be an expensive activity. When you are browsing through dress shops, remember to look a dresses that are not officially categorized as wedding dresses. A bridesmaid dress, for example, could look stunning on your figure and will typically be less than half the price of an actual wedding gown. Even if you think you would like to change it in some way, it should be less expensive than if you bought a wedding dress.

You can save a lot of money by purchasing your wedding gown online. However, remember to give yourself plenty of time for alterations. I only spent $100 on my gown when I was married, but I spent another $200 on having it altered. Make sure the costs are included in your budget.

Go easy on the number of fresh flowers you put on the guest tables for your wedding reception. The majority of the time, these flowers are in the guests’ way. Additionally, many people are allergic to flowers. Because of this, you should think about putting candles that are non-scented onto the table in order to achieve a more romantic look.

Instead of traditional floral bouquets, brides can adorn their bouquet with diamonds, rhinestones or other gems. You can do this by applying some crystals, costume jewelry, or maybe even an heirloom piece. To make sure that it matches well with your ensemble, you need to be consistent when it comes to the size, cut and the color of the stones.
